Tunisia-[Audio]:What is happening in Sfax? Governor of the region Clarifies

Speaking to Tunisie Numérique, Sfax Governor Anis Oueslati affirmed today that medical personnel have carried out a preventive operation to avoid oxygen deficiencies in hospitals in the region. As a result, 33 patients were moved in ambulances, including those belonging to private clinics at the military hospital in Sfax.

Remarking that the operation was carried out following a delay in the oxygen supply, Oueslati declared that hospitals were supplied with oxygen from the early hours of the morning.
